理解它们,对于我们编写健壮安全的PHP应用至关重要。
实现步骤 私有化构造函数: 将类的构造函数设为 private 或 protected。
浮点运算库 并非所有浮点运算都能直接由硬件指令支持,尤其是一些复杂的数学函数(如三角函数、对数等)。
尽管GobEncoder允许自定义数据编码,但Go是静态编译语言,不支持运行时代码生成。
遍历通道(channel) for range 还可用于从通道中持续接收数据,直到通道关闭。
占位符可以是任何独特的字符串,例如 {loser}、[loser] 或 {{loser}}。
因此,当你在 Go 代码中看到 rune 类型时,你应该将其理解为“一个 Unicode 字符”。
flush() 操作将对象的状态同步到数据库,并解析了对象之间的关系。
官方推荐: 它是SQLAlchemy官方推荐的构建复杂连接URL的方式,更符合框架的设计哲学。
当数据量较小,或者计算本身非常简单时,goroutine的创建和同步开销可能会超过并行计算带来的收益。
防御常见安全威胁 用户输入不可信,必须对每一项数据做上下文适配。
事务处理: 使用数据库事务,确保数据更新的原子性。
接口支持多继承,类实现多个接口 PHP类不支持多继承,但可以实现多个接口,这使得类能具备多种行为特征。
安装Python需下载官网推荐版本并勾选Add Python to PATH,安装后通过cmd输入python --version验证,成功返回版本号即可运行脚本。
只要包含 <compare> 并合理使用 operator<=>,就能轻松实现现代 C++ 的高效比较逻辑。
本教程探讨如何在Python中以类矩阵形式显示数据,尤其关注如何通过动态调整逗号后的间距来改善可读性。
在最初的代码示例中,Engine 结构体的 Start() 方法使用了值接收器: 立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”;func (engine Engine) Start() { fmt.Println("Inside the Start() func, started starts off", engine.started) engine.started = true fmt.Println("Inside the Start() func, then turns to", engine.started) }这意味着 Start() 方法修改的是 engine 变量的一个副本,而不是原始的 Engine 实例。
attempt(task) 函数只是简单地检查任务是否完成并打印结果。
recover 必须配合 defer 使用,否则无法拦截 panic。
异步流的优势和适用场景 异步流解决了传统集合在大数据量或高延迟 IO 场景下的内存和性能问题。
本文链接:http://www.douglasjamesguitar.com/183121_8594e8.html